Output 2d8beac7791ac191f4b840a0d553e5b58b085270f0884b2a7a2f0c8ed4d10244:8

value
15057859
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b3dc77bc72631c2c546c404ae425198489d95f72bad64a0a448f45101482ab89
address
tb1pk0w800rjvvwzc4rvgp9wgfgesjyajhmjhtty5zjy3az3q9yz4wys8nzm5j
transaction
2d8beac7791ac191f4b840a0d553e5b58b085270f0884b2a7a2f0c8ed4d10244
confirmations
15911
spent
true